多数のデバイス (1 日に 1 回、同時に 5 万台以上のデバイス) に対して異なるメッセージでプッシュ通知を送信する必要があります。
APNSサービスでそのことに気づきました。しかし、GCMの場合、私は少し混乱しています。
それを実現するためのベストプラクティスは何ですか?デバイスとメッセージの配列をループして、http 経由で 1 つずつ撮影するとどうなりますか? それは良い考えですか?
サーバー側でPHPを使用しています
多数のデバイス (1 日に 1 回、同時に 5 万台以上のデバイス) に対して異なるメッセージでプッシュ通知を送信する必要があります。
APNSサービスでそのことに気づきました。しかし、GCMの場合、私は少し混乱しています。
それを実現するためのベストプラクティスは何ですか?デバイスとメッセージの配列をループして、http 経由で 1 つずつ撮影するとどうなりますか? それは良い考えですか?
サーバー側でPHPを使用しています
それを実現するためのベストプラクティスは何ですか?
それらが本当に異なるメッセージである場合は、一度に 1 つずつ行うしかありません。GCM はメッセージごとに最大 1000 台のデバイスをサポートしますが、これは同じメッセージに対するものであり、別のメッセージに対するものではありません。
デバイスとメッセージの配列をループして、http 経由で 1 つずつ撮影するとどうなりますか? それは良い考えですか?
それはうまくいくはずです。
そうは言っても、GCM Cloud Connection Server (CCS)の使用を検討することをお勧めします。これは、「HTTP の代わりに長寿命のソケットを使用して、XMPP 経由でメッセージを送信する」という手の込んだ方法です。